non toxic dog toys: Pure Delight for Pets

Non toxic dog toys are made with safe materials like TPE, hemp, natural rubber, or organic cotton. They steer clear of chemicals like BPA, phthalates, lead, or latex, which means no harmful surprises during play.

By leaving out dangerous chemicals, these toys help lower long-term health risks while offering endless fun for your furry buddy. Ever notice how a playful pup’s tail wags just a bit faster when they’re using a toy made with care?

Manufacturers follow helpful guidelines like CPSIA and ASTM F963 since there isn’t one main US agency watching over dog toy safety. This careful approach means every toy gets made with your pet’s well-being in mind.

For example, a 2007 study found a tiny bit of lead (1 part per million) in a Chinese-made toy. It’s a reminder that even small amounts can matter, sort of like how a pinch too much salt can spoil an otherwise healthy meal.

Choosing toxin-free pet products is important because it helps cut down on harmful substances your pet might ingest while playing. Key Natural Materials in Non Toxic Dog Toys

img-1.jpg

Non toxic dog toys are built with safe, natural ingredients that let your pup play without worry. Take hemp rope toys, for example. They’re made from braided fibers that stand up to heavy chewing and are perfect for tug-of-war and fetch. Plus, they break down naturally, just like your kitchen scraps when you compost them at home.

Another cool material is Zogoflex TPE. This plant-based, stretchy treat can stretch up to 400 times its size without snapping. Made in Bozeman, MT, it’s approved by the FDA and can be recycled endlessly. Think of it like a super-strong rubber band that keeps its bounce, tough enough for energetic dogs yet gentle on our planet.

Natural rubber is also a smart choice. It’s pure, flexible, and free from latex, making it a safe option for dogs who love to chew. Many organic dog toys even use organic cotton stuffing as their filling. This soft, hypoallergenic material, grown in the USA, adds a cozy touch to stuffed hemp dog bones, perfect for gentle chewers who like a little cuddle.

All these materials come together to create toys that are safe for your furry friend and kind to nature. Every part is made to last, giving your dog hours of secure, joyful play.

Certified Standards and Testing for Truly Safe Dog Toys

When you're on the lookout for safe toys for your dog, it helps to know that the best brands do more than just meet the basic rules. Take West Paw, for example. They proudly show off their Certified B Corp™ status, which means they care a lot about making products the right way and even keep production local. You might see a tag that says "Tested under ASTM F963". It’s a reminder that every toy is given a careful check, just like a safety net for your furry friend.

Toy makers use extra tests set by groups like the FDA and follow guidelines like CPSIA and ASTM F963. These tests look for bad stuff such as lead, phthalates (chemicals sometimes found in plastics), and other heavy metals. Think of these tests as a quick health checkup for the toys. Since there isn’t one big government list of all the chemicals used in pet products, what you know about each toy often comes from what the maker shares with you.

Some brands go even further by offering creative recycling programs to keep things eco-friendly. For example, Zogoflex materials are known for being incredibly tough. When these materials are returned, they get turned into new toys without losing quality. It’s a win-win: your pet gets a fun toy, and you support a more Earth-friendly approach.

Knowing what these tests and certifications mean can really help you choose toys that are made with care right here in the USA. Top Non Toxic Dog Toys: Comparative Table of Materials and Durability

img-2.jpg

When your furry friend loves to chew, you need a toy that can handle even the toughest bites. This easy-to-read table shows you all the key details, like what the toy is made of, the ideal breed sizes, durability ratings, and prices, so you can pick the perfect, safe toy for your pet. Every product here is chosen with your pet's safety and fun in mind. For example, if your pup is a heavy chewer, you might want to check out the Zogoflex D-Lux. It even comes recommended for tough chewers. Just think about it like choosing the best treat for your dog: the stronger the bite, the tougher the toy needed.

Toy Material Ideal Breed Size Durability Rating Price
Zogoflex Tux TPE Medium breeds 5/5 $26
Zogoflex Fetch TPE Echo® (post-consumer recycled) Large breeds 4/5 $28
Hemp Rope Tug Braided hemp All sizes 4/5 $15
Plush Hemp Dog Bone Hemp exterior + organic cotton stuffing Small breeds 2/5 $18
Zogoflex D-Lux Thicker TPE Heavy chewers 5/5 $30

This clear chart makes it simple to decide which toy fits your dog's chewing style and size. Whether you need something durable for rough play or a gentler option for nibbling, this guide has you covered. Plus, the durability ratings are based on real-life tests and feedback from other pet lovers, so you can trust that your pet will stay safe during their playful moments.

How to Select the Best Non Toxic Dog Toys for Your Pet

When you're picking a toy for your pup, start by thinking about how they chew. Match the toy's size and design to your dog's breed and temperament. For example, a sturdy toy might be perfect for an energetic chewer, while a softer option works better for a gentle play style. And always take a good look at the label, if the toy is made with materials like PVC or silicone blends, check that there aren’t any unfamiliar additives that might be harmful.

Next, look for signs of quality like third-party testing and certifications such as CPSIA, FDA, or B Corp. These marks mean that the materials and making process have been carefully checked for safety. Also, read what other pet parents have to say. Their reviews can give you a real insight into how well a toy holds up and whether it has any strange odors or shows early signs of wear.

Finally, think about how much you’re willing to spend versus how long the toy might last. Sometimes, spending a little extra on toys made from TPE can really pay off, they tend to stand up to heavy chewing better than some of the cheaper options. With these handy tips, you'll be set to choose safe, fun play items that keep your pet happy and healthy.

Care, Cleaning, and Recycling Practices for Long-Lasting Non Toxic Dog Toys

img-3.jpg

Taking care of your pet's safe dog toys means more fun and fewer replacements. Every week, give those toys a gentle wash with a bit of mild dish soap mixed in warm water, then let them air dry completely. It’s like a little health check for your favorite playthings, keeping them fresh and inviting.

Switch up the toys each week to give each one a well-deserved break. This simple trick helps them stay in great shape and even cuts down on waste. Believe it or not, dogs in the U.S. end up tossing nearly seven toys a year! Imagine the difference you can help make.

  • Wash toys weekly using mild dish soap and warm water, then let them air dry fully.
  • Rotate your toy set every week to keep wear and tear at bay.
  • Inspect any TPE toys for cracks and send any damaged ones back to the manufacturer for recycling. TPE is a kind of material that can be recycled over and over.
  • When hemp rope toys start to show frayed fibers, compost them since natural fibers break down within just a few months.

By using these tips, your pet gets safe playtime while you help keep the planet healthy.
